PVC crystal Waterstop with bulb

The kind of PVC used means the WATERSTOP can be used on concrete structures exposed to temperatures between -30°C and +70°C. This ensures noticeable resistance to ageing, chemical attacks in alkaline environments, brackish water and acid solutions.

They are resistant to degradation caused by chemicals normally present in groundwater. They are highly flexible even at low temperatures. Their mechanical features stay the same over time. They are compatible with prefabricated synthetic PVC membranes.
